Gold Catalyst Market

The gold catalyst market is a specialized segment within industrial catalysis, leveraging the unique electronic and surface properties of gold nanoparticles to enable selective and efficient chemical reactions under mild conditions. Unlike bulk gold, nanoscale gold exhibits remarkable catalytic activity, particularly in oxidation, reduction, and environmental remediation processes. The market’s growth is driven by increasing demand for sustainable chemical processes, emission control technologies, and green chemistry solutions that minimize environmental footprints.

Regulatory pressures to reduce harmful emissions in automotive and industrial sectors have further catalyzed investments in catalytic converters and emission abatement systems. Technological advancements in nanotechnology, surface chemistry, and material science have expanded the application scope of gold catalysts, supporting scalable production and tailored properties. Value creation occurs at the intersection of technological innovation and industrial application, with leading players investing heavily in R&D to optimize catalyst performance, durability, and cost-effectiveness.

Market dynamics

Why the number moves this way

The forces expanding this market and the ones holding it back — each broken down into distinct, scannable points.

Growth drivers

Pulling the market up

  • Regulatory Pressures for Emission Reduction Stringent environmental regulations, particularly in automotive and industrial sectors, are driving demand for gold catalysts in catalytic converters and emission abatement systems. These catalysts enable efficient conversion of harmful pollutants, supporting compliance with global emission standards.
  • Demand for Sustainable Chemical Processes Industries are increasingly adopting green chemistry solutions to minimize environmental footprints. Gold catalysts, with their high selectivity and efficiency under mild conditions, are well-suited for sustainable chemical synthesis and environmental remediation.
  • Technological Advancements in Nanomaterials Innovations in nanotechnology and surface engineering have enabled the scalable production of gold catalysts with tailored properties. These advancements enhance catalytic performance, durability, and cost-effectiveness, broadening the scope of applications.
  • Expansion of Industrial Applications Gold catalysts are being integrated into diverse industrial processes, including petroleum refining, chemical synthesis, and environmental remediation. Their versatility and efficiency make them a preferred choice for high-value applications.

Restraints

Holding it back

  • High Production Costs The cost of high-purity gold nanoparticles and advanced manufacturing processes remains a significant barrier to market entry and scalability. This limits adoption in cost-sensitive industries and regions.
  • Supply Chain Vulnerabilities The gold catalyst market is dependent on the supply of high-purity gold, which is subject to price volatility and geopolitical risks. Disruptions in the supply chain can impact production timelines and costs.
  • Competition from Alternative Catalysts Platinum group metal (PGM) catalysts and other advanced materials pose competition to gold catalysts, particularly in applications where cost or performance advantages favor alternatives.
  • Regulatory and Compliance Challenges The development and deployment of gold catalysts must comply with stringent environmental and safety regulations, which can delay market entry and increase operational costs.

Regulatory landscape

Policy and standards affecting the forecast

Material regulatory shifts across the major regional markets. The report tracks these quarter-by-quarter and quantifies their forecast impact.

  1. United States

    EPA TSCA · OSHA · TRI

    EPA TSCA (Toxic Substances Control Act, revised 2016) requires premanufacture notification for new chemicals; 8000+ existing chemicals under prioritisation review. OSHA HazCom aligned with GHS. Toxics Release Inventory (TRI) reporting required for 800+ chemicals across 20K facilities.

  2. European Union

    REACH · CLP · Chemicals Strategy

    REACH (Registration, Evaluation, Authorisation, Restriction of Chemicals) covers 23,000+ substances. CLP Regulation aligns EU with GHS. Chemicals Strategy for Sustainability targets phase-out of "most harmful" substances by 2030. PFAS restriction proposal covers 10,000+ compounds.

  3. China / APAC

    MEE new chemical · GB safety standards

    MEE new-chemical registration (Order 12) mandatory since 2021 — mirrors EU REACH but with different data waivers. China Chemical Registration Center (CCRC) processes ~500 new substance notifications/year. Japan's CSCL and Korea's K-REACH add region-specific requirements.

  4. Global standards

    GHS · Rotterdam · Stockholm

    GHS (Globally Harmonised System) standardises hazard classification across 70+ countries. Rotterdam Convention governs hazardous chemical trade (PIC procedure). Stockholm Convention on Persistent Organic Pollutants (POPs) bans/restricts 34 substance groups; ongoing PFAS additions.
